'Kalyana Lakshmi' will benefit over 58,000 girls: Jogu Ramanna Hyderabad, May 13 (INN): BC Welfare Minister Jogu Ramanna said that the Telangana Government was taking all measures for effective implementation of 'Kalyana Lakshmi' scheme which provides Rs. 51,000 cash incentive to the poor girls at the time of their marriage.
Speaking to media persons after launching the website of Kalyana Lakshmi scheme at the State Secretariat here on Friday, the minister said that the schemes, which was earlier confined to SCs and STs, has been extended to BCs and OBCs from current financial year. He said Rs. 300 crore have been earmarked for the scheme which would benefit 58,820 poor girls.
The minister advised people to avoid middlemen and discourage any irregularities. He said on furnishing all required documents, the State Government directly deposits the amount in the account of beneficiaries.
BC Welfare Principal Secretary Somesh Kumar, Commissioner BC Welfare G.D. Aruna, BC Residential Schools Secretary Mallaiah and other senior officials were also present on the occasion. Later, the minister also unveiled the new logo of BC Welfare Schools.
